2. BROKEN JEWELLERY
We recommend: Poh Seng Jewellers.
Fix broken jewellery hooks and settings, resize rings, and even polish and smooth chipped jade. Pat Lee, 41, a teacher, said that Poh Seng “is a reputable shop” that she trusts. The hook of her diamond bracelet was replaced by a replica of the old one.

Poh Seng Jewellers is located at 227 New Bridge Road, Tel: 6223 8605. Rates range from $10 to repair a hook to a few hundred dollars to change diamond settings."
